In Drosophila, seven partial deletions (1 to 7) shown as gaps in the diagram below have been mapped on a chromosome. This region of the chromosome contains genes that express seven recessive mutant phenotypes, identified in the following table as a through g.
A researcher wants to determine the location and order of genes on the chromosome, so he sets up a series of crosses in which flies homozygous for a mutant allele are crossed with flies that are homozygous for a partial deletion. The progeny are scored to determine whether they have the mutant phenotype (“m” in the table), or the wild-type phenotype (“+” in the table).
